This volume describes the formation and properties of soils necessary to appreciate soil differences. Emphasis is placed on some of the important management concerns in using soils. The book focuses on soils in arid, humid, temperate and tropical climates. It treats soils as the principal medium for all productive agriculture. The new edition features new chapters on tillage systems and fertilizer management and revised material on nutrients, soils and environmental pollution and fertility diagnosis. It also covers accepted units for soil water and chemical data in place of obsolete units. There is a more extensive discussion on allelopath, soil humus, micro-nutrients and sulphur, and calculations for various simple and complex fertilizer formulations are included. It also presents two new taxonomy units: kandic horizon and the tentative eleventh soil order, Andisols.
